From ce7f84540a16f528b4087a50f69e650d7fee5816 Mon Sep 17 00:00:00 2001 From: Sergey Sychugin <40148988+sychugin@users.noreply.github.com> Date: Sat, 20 Jul 2024 13:23:23 +0300 Subject: [PATCH] Add Neo-Tree and Autopairs plugins --- init.lua | 4 ++-- lua/kickstart/plugins/neo-tree.lua | 8 ++++++++ 2 files changed, 10 insertions(+), 2 deletions(-) diff --git a/init.lua b/init.lua index b3c49064..ba11ddfc 100644 --- a/init.lua +++ b/init.lua @@ -942,8 +942,8 @@ require('lazy').setup({ -- require 'kickstart.plugins.debug', -- require 'kickstart.plugins.indent_line', -- require 'kickstart.plugins.lint', - -- require 'kickstart.plugins.autopairs', - -- require 'kickstart.plugins.neo-tree', + require 'kickstart.plugins.autopairs', + require 'kickstart.plugins.neo-tree', -- require 'kickstart.plugins.gitsigns', -- adds gitsigns recommend keymaps -- NOTE: The import below can automatically add your own plugins, configuration, etc from `lua/custom/plugins/*.lua` diff --git a/lua/kickstart/plugins/neo-tree.lua b/lua/kickstart/plugins/neo-tree.lua index c793b885..3e0d8b9e 100644 --- a/lua/kickstart/plugins/neo-tree.lua +++ b/lua/kickstart/plugins/neo-tree.lua @@ -14,8 +14,16 @@ return { { '\\', ':Neotree reveal', { desc = 'NeoTree reveal' } }, }, opts = { + close_if_last_window = true, -- Закрывать Neo-tree, если это последнее окно + popup_border_style = 'rounded', -- Закругленные углы у всплывающих окон + + enable_git_status = true, -- Показ статусов Git + enable_diagnostics = true, -- Показ диагностик + filesystem = { window = { + width = 30, -- Ширина окна + position = 'left', mappings = { ['\\'] = 'close_window', },